I have a project that uses the audio library to do a bunch of mixing, routing, and analysis. I'd like to use some pretty neat WS2812 LEDs as indicators, since I just discovered them in the 2020 package.
I am doing a few experiments and I am seeing that the Audio library interrupts are interfering with FastLED writing the strip. I have disabled the Audio interrupt while writing to the strips, but I can't check if that's messing up the audio at this moment. I will be able to listen later tonight hopefully.
I am using the Audio Shield, as well as I2C for a display driver.
I will have two strips, one with 34 LEDs, the other with 26.
Is there a better library than FastLED to use for this purpose? I assume OctoWS2812 would be more efficient since it uses DMA, but based on my reading of the page I need to reserve all 8 pins for it if I use it, and I can't dedicate that many pins to empty strips.
